Definition

Inmate: a person confined to an institution, especially a prison.

Sample Sentences

  1. The inmate spent his time reading books in the prison library.
  2. Each inmate was given the opportunity to participate in vocational training programs.
  3. She felt a deep sense of empathy for the inmate who shared his life story during the meeting.
  4. The rehabilitation program aimed to help the inmate reintegrate into society after his release.
  5. During the lockdown, the inmate remained calm and followed the guards' instructions.
  6. After years of rehabilitation, the inmate was finally granted parole.
  7. Each inmate had a unique story that contributed to their time behind bars.
  8. The prison's overcrowding problem was exacerbated by the rising number of inmates.
  9. She volunteered at the facility to provide support and education for the inmates.
